Introduction

Kate M. Ferriter, an accomplished inventor based in Atlanta, GA, has made significant contributions to the field of manufacturing efficiency. With a portfolio of seven patents, her innovations focus on enhancing the productivity of manufacturing technicians through novel methods and systems.

Latest Patents

Among her notable inventions is the "Method and Apparatus for Measurement of Manufacturing Technician." This patented technology introduces a system for assessing the efficiency of manufacturing technicians as they carry out specific operations within a computer-based manufacturing process. The methodology includes storing a manufacturing process plan in a computer system with a visual display. Each operation's labor standard time value is identified and tracked, allowing for real-time monitoring of elapsed and remaining time during the operation.

Another significant contribution is the "Method and System for Generation of Manufacturing Process Plans." This invention allows for the efficient creation of manufacturing process plans by capturing or generating visual images of products and displaying them alongside a library of iconic representations of manufacturing steps. Operators can select desired steps, alter textual instructions using a text editor, and utilize sequentially numbered instructions for enhanced workflow management.
